Transaction 89e502abe459a93875ca9371194035a515d0eda437ac66994101cc79847045fb

1 Input
2 Outputs
  • 89e502abe459a93875ca9371194035a515d0eda437ac66994101cc79847045fb:0
  • value  918520112
    address  37kjn14ZXqemgXAyk6dwtXgapKGLhVcogE
  • 89e502abe459a93875ca9371194035a515d0eda437ac66994101cc79847045fb:1
  • value  2150913
    address  176NpiqpJVzGcb5W8fBNVcYvrUUGxsBTr5